国产成人毛片视频|星空传媒久草视频|欧美激情草久视频|久久久久女女|久操超碰在线播放|亚洲强奸一区二区|五月天丁香社区在线|色婷婷成人丁香网|午夜欧美6666|纯肉无码91视频

java將字符串日期格式化 Java字符串日期格式化詳解

在Java開發(fā)中,經(jīng)常會遇到需要對字符串日期進(jìn)行格式化的情況。Java提供了SimpleDateFormat類來幫助開發(fā)者進(jìn)行字符串日期的格式化和解析。1. 實例化SimpleDateFormat對象

在Java開發(fā)中,經(jīng)常會遇到需要對字符串日期進(jìn)行格式化的情況。Java提供了SimpleDateFormat類來幫助開發(fā)者進(jìn)行字符串日期的格式化和解析。

1. 實例化SimpleDateFormat對象

要使用SimpleDateFormat類進(jìn)行字符串日期格式化,首先需要實例化一個SimpleDateFormat對象。可以通過以下方式進(jìn)行實例化:

```java

SimpleDateFormat sdf new SimpleDateFormat("yyyy-MM-dd");

```

這里的"yyyy-MM-dd"就是我們指定的日期格式,可以根據(jù)自己需要進(jìn)行調(diào)整。

2. 格式化日期

利用實例化的SimpleDateFormat對象,可以將日期對象或字符串按照指定的格式進(jìn)行格式化。示例代碼如下:

```java

Date date new Date();

String formattedDate (date);

(formattedDate);

```

上述代碼將當(dāng)前日期格式化為"yyyy-MM-dd"的字符串,并打印輸出。

3. 解析字符串為日期

除了將日期對象格式化為字符串,還可以將字符串解析為日期對象。示例代碼如下:

```java

String dateString "2022-01-01";

Date parsedDate (dateString);

(parsedDate);

```

上述代碼將字符串"2022-01-01"解析為對應(yīng)的日期對象,并打印輸出。

4. 自定義日期格式

除了常見的"yyyy-MM-dd"格式外,SimpleDateFormat還支持多種自定義的日期格式。以下是一些常用的格式示例:

- "yyyy-MM-dd HH:mm:ss":年-月-日 時:分:秒

- "yyyy年MM月dd日":年月日

- "HH:mm:ss":時:分:秒

通過指定不同的日期格式,可以靈活地進(jìn)行日期的格式化和解析。

總結(jié):

本文介紹了Java中使用SimpleDateFormat類對字符串日期進(jìn)行格式化的方法。通過實例化SimpleDateFormat對象、調(diào)用format()方法將日期格式化為字符串、調(diào)用parse()方法將字符串解析為日期,可以方便地處理字符串日期的格式轉(zhuǎn)換。同時,還提供了一些常用的日期格式示例,幫助讀者了解和掌握日期格式化的技巧。在實際開發(fā)中,根據(jù)具體需求選擇合適的日期格式,能夠提高代碼的可讀性和靈活性。